Best Practices for Designing and Conducting Scientific Experiments

science

When designing and conducting scientific experiments in Karachi or any other city, adhering to best practices is paramount for accurate results and meaningful insights. The first step involves clearly defining the research question and hypothesis, ensuring they are specific and testable. This provides a clear direction for your experiment and guides data analysis later. Next, carefully select appropriate methods and techniques that align with your objectives; consider variables, controls, and replication to maintain validity and reliability.

Additionally, ethical considerations cannot be overlooked. Ensure experiments comply with local guidelines and involve informed consent when dealing with human subjects or their data. Proper safety protocols are equally important to protect researchers and the environment. Lastly, maintain detailed records of methodologies, observations, and results for transparency and future reference in the fast-paced world of Karachi’s scientific community.
